Hearty Vegan Cabbage Rolls Recipe

  • Total Time: 85 minutes
  • Yield: 5 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 large napa cabbage (1012 leaves)
  • 1 ¼ cups (250 g) sushi rice or short-grain rice
  • 8 white button mushrooms (diced, canned or fresh)
  • 1 medium (120 g) carrot (diced)
  • 2 medium (70 g) peppers (diced)
  • 1 medium onion (diced)
  • 3 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 tbsp ginger (minced)
  • 2 tbsps tamari or coconut aminos
  • ½ tsp sea salt
  • ½ tsp ground pepper
  • ½ tsp onion powder
  • ¼ tsp red pepper flakes (or to taste)
  • 1 tsp oil (sesame oil)
  • ½ tbsp ginger (minced)
  • 2 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 ½ tbsps tamari or coconut aminos
  • 1 tbsp rice vinegar
  • ¾ tbsp maple syrup
  • ½ cup (120 ml) water
  • ½ tbsp cornstarch
  • salt (to taste)
  • pepper (to taste)
  • red pepper flakes (to taste)
  • smoked paprika (to taste)
  • sesame seeds (to garnish)

Instructions

  1. Rice Preparation: Thoroughly rinse sushi rice, soak for an hour, then simmer in salted water until tender and fluffy.
  2. Cabbage Preparation: Blanch cabbage leaves in boiling water for 2-3 minutes, immediately transfer to ice bath, then drain and set aside.
  3. Vegetable Sauté: In a skillet, heat oil and sauté onions, ginger, garlic, carrots, peppers, and mushrooms until fragrant and slightly translucent, then incorporate tamari and spices.
  4. Filling Creation: Blend cooked rice into the vegetable mixture, ensuring even distribution of ingredients.
  5. Rolling Technique: Place softened cabbage leaf flat, center rice mixture, fold edges inward, and roll tightly to form compact parcels.
  6. Searing Process: In a hot skillet with oil, brown cabbage rolls on all sides until a golden crust develops.
  7. Sauce Crafting: Sauté ginger and garlic, add tamari, rice vinegar, and maple syrup, create cornstarch slurry to thicken sauce until glossy.
  8. Final Presentation: Arrange cabbage rolls on serving plate, generously drizzle with prepared sauce, and garnish with sesame seeds.

Notes

  • Rinse Rice Carefully: Thorough rinsing removes excess starch, ensuring fluffy and separate rice grains for perfect texture.
  • Soften Cabbage Gently: Blanching leaves prevents tearing and makes rolling easier, creating neat, professional-looking cabbage rolls.
  • Sauté Vegetables Precisely: Cooking vegetables until fragrant but not fully soft maintains their texture and enhances overall flavor profile.
  • Thicken Sauce Strategically: Using cornstarch creates a glossy, restaurant-quality sauce that clings beautifully to cabbage rolls, elevating the dish’s presentation.
